- The distance between Tamatave/ Toamasina, Madagascar and Bamiyan, Afghanistan is approximately 6,199 km or 3,852 mi.
- To reach Tamatave/ Toamasina in this distance one would set out from Bamiyan bearing 201.3° or SS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Tamatave/ Toamasina bearing 198.3° or SSW .
- Tamatave/ Toamasina has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Bamiyan has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k).
- Tamatave/ Toamasina is in or near the subtropical wet forest biome whereas Bamiyan is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 16.5 °C (29.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.1 °C (34.4°F) less in Tamatave/ Toamasina.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 3235.2 mm (127.4 in) more which is equivalent to 3235.2 l/m² (79.4 US gal/ft²) or 32,352,000 l/ha (3,458,644 US gal/ac) more. About 25 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 14.1° higher in Tamatave/ Toamasina than in Bamiyan.
